			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The UK Environment Film Fellowships have been awarded every year since 2005 to Indian environmental filmmakers.</p>
<p>Four fellowships will be awarded, through a countrywide bidding process, to a team of environmental filmmakers and climate change professionals or institutions; to make 12 minute documentaries on this year’s theme.</p>
<p>The fellowships are open to a join team comprising a filmmaker and climate change professional/ expert/ institution. The competition is open to Indian filmmakers only. Applicants should have a working experience in filmmaking. A filmmaker can submit more than one proposal based on any or both theme.</p>
<p>Last date for submission is 2<sup>nd</sup> November.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/radcliffe.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-770" title="radcliffe" src="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/radcliffe-150x150.jpg" alt="radcliffe" width="150" height="150" /></a>The Radcliffe Institute fellowship programme supports scientists, scholars, artists and writers of exceptional promise and demonstrated accomplishment, providing them with support to focus on their work for an academic year, unfettered by other obligations.</p>
<p>Candidates in any field with a PhD in the area of the proposed project by Dec 2008 are eligible. Stipends for one year with additional funds for project expenses are up to $65,000. The fellowship extends from early September 2010 to 30<sup>th</sup> June 2011.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.radcliffe.edu/fellowships/apply.aspx">Applications are now available</a> for the 2010–2011 fellowship year. Last date for applications in the natural sciences and mathematics is November 15, 2009.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/williams.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-753" title="williams" src="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/williams-150x150.jpg" alt="williams" width="150" height="150" /></a>Williams College is accepting applications for two post-doctoral fellowships in environmental studies, beginning in 1<sup>st</sup> July, 2010.</p>
<p>Candidates with a PhD or who have completed their PhD within the last five years will be eligible.</p>
<p>Successful candidates will be appointed for a one or two year term and will carry a teaching load of one course each semester. The stipend is $38,940 per year plus an allowance of $4,500 for research and professional travel expenses.</p>
<p>Applications must be postmarked by 31<sup>st</sup> Dec, 2009.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/cambridge.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-750" title="cambridge" src="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/cambridge-150x150.jpg" alt="cambridge" width="150" height="150" /></a>University of Cambridge announced the Dr. Manmohan Singh scholarship 2010 offering 35,000 pounds scholarship per students at St. John’s College, UK.</p>
<p>Application from Indian students with a PhD degree will be eligible for scholarships for up to three years with three scholarships already planned for 2010-11.</p>
<p>Applications are open and the closing date for the scholarships is 15 Dec, 2009.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/Macalester-College.JPG"><img class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-747" title="Macalester College" src="http://www.genxnews.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/Macalester-College-150x150.jpg" alt="Macalester College" width="150" height="150" /></a>Macalester College is accepting applications for a two year Winston &amp; amp; Maxine Wallin postdoctoral faculty fellowship from recent PhDs or those who have completed their PhD within the last 5 years focusing on the Islamic world. Candidates may also come from social science or humanitarian discipline.</p>
<p>The fellowship will begin in September 2010 and entails half time teaching. Candidates should be interested in teaching in a rigorous liberal arts environment. And also hold promise of substantial original scholarship.</p>
<p>The stipend includes a $57,000 salary plus benefits and funds to support research and travel. Applications must be postmarked by 15<sup>th</sup> November, 2009.</p>
